The initial lineup for this year's Glastonbury Festival has been revealed, featuring headliners The 1975, Neil Young, and Olivia Rodrigo. Alongside them are acts confirmed in this announcement, including recent BRIT winner Charli XCX, Loyle Carner, Biffy Clyro, RAYE, Doechii, Wolf Alice, English Teacher, and former Little Mix member JADE, among many others, promising an exciting weekend. Last month’s cover star Self Esteem will also return to the Tor, along with performers like The Maccabees, Deftones, Ezra Collective, Wet Leg, and ’90s icon Alanis Morissette. This significant announcement follows Rod Stewart's confirmation last December of his intent to play the Legends slot, while Neil Young had previously stated his plans to headline, later retracting and then reaffirming them. Glastonbury 2025 is scheduled to take place at Worthy Farm from June 25th to 29th. You can find the current lineup poster below.
